ChatPod: preguntas y respuestas sobre tus podcasts
Visite ChatPod en https://chatpod.onrender.com (Actualmente inactivo, envíeme un ping si desea ver la demostración)
Contexto
- Con la creciente popularidad de los podcasts, reconocimos la necesidad de una forma más eficiente de buscar y extraer información relevante de estos archivos de audio.
- Este proyecto (ChatPod) aprovecha el poder de ChatGPT para procesar con precisión consultas en lenguaje natural y recuperar partes relevantes de las transcripciones del podcast.
Herramientas
- Feedparser: procesamiento de fuentes RSS
- Susurro: voz a texto
- FAISS: Vectorstore
- LangChain: marco general de backend
- OpenAI ChatGPT: modelo de lenguaje grande (
gpt-turbo-3.5
) - Streamlit: interfaz frontal
- Renderizado: Implementación de la aplicación Dockerizada (cron-job.org para mantener la instancia activa)
Hacer